| CarolRobinson's Full Review: Logitech Marble Mouse (904360-0215) Trackball |
Because of wrist problems that I have that predate my using a computer, it's easiest and most comfortable for me to use a trackball. Since, between home and work, I am on a computer 10+ hours a day, comfort is key. The Logitech Marble Mouse, despite the name, is a trackball - and this is the model I use at home. It's my personal favorite. The shape is designed perfectly for people with varying sized hands. Since my hands are very small, a larger-sized input device can be wearing after a while. The two buttons, one on either side of the ball itself, are very sensitive and register clicks from any point. Since the ball is optical, depending on the little black dots, the ball requires very little cleaning. Frequency of cleaning is a problem I've had with most other trackball models I've used, and I appreciate this feature very much. This product gets my highest recommendation.
